Exciting boom recruit Sam Lalor has landed an endorsement deal with Australian underwear brand Bonds after experiencing a wardrobe mishap during his AFL debut last Thursday evening.
The highly anticipated No.1 draft pick from last year played a pivotal role in Richmond’s thrilling 13-point comeback victory over Carlton, achieving 18 disposals, two goals, and eight score involvements.
However, the 18-year-old showcased more than just his impressive skills in their season opener at the MCG.

During the celebration of his second goal, cameras captured the awkward moment when Lalor’s shorts failed to contain him, leading to a brief exposure.
Following the match, the young talent seemed to acknowledge the slip-up, referencing it in his Instagram post celebrating his debut.
“What a night. Cheers to Richmond for the opportunity—looking forward to many more ahead,” he wrote, adding an eggplant emoji for a touch of humour.
Teammate Tim Taranto cleverly tagged Bonds Australia’s Instagram in the post, drawing the brand’s attention.
In a light-hearted response, Bonds joined the fun, providing Lalor with some men’s trunks to ensure he is properly secured in the future.
In a social media clip showcasing Lalor’s original post, Bonds announced they would supply him with new underwear, also offering fans a little something special.
“You might have heard about Sammy’s fantastic round-one debut last Thursday and the not-so-great moment when his boys were a bit too exposed during his celebration,” a representative in Bonds’ video explained.
“Tim was kind enough to alert us, so we thought we’d reach out to Sammy and make sure he’s got the right coverage for his next game with some Bonds trunks.”
It remains unclear whether this partnership is just a one-off or if Lalor will take on a brand ambassador role like his predecessor in the Tigers midfield, Dustin Martin.
The Richmond great was the face of various Bonds men’s collections during the final stages of his career.
Bonds also took the opportunity to market the ‘Sammy Lalor edit’, featuring a range of men’s underwear “that will keep your essentials secure, supported, and comfortable this footy season,” with an enticing 22 per cent discount to match Lalor’s jersey number.
“Ensure you don’t get caught out, on or off the field, with your eggplant showing,” the video concluded on a cheeky note.
Lalor’s standout performance against the Blues earned him a nomination for the AFL Rising Star Award for round one.
